Jay Stevens is joined by Richard Chernomaz via phone to talk about his hockey career beginning in British Columbia, getting drafted by the Colorado Rockies in 1981, and moving up from the junior level to pro,

We also dive into his time in Salt Lake City, UT for the Golden Eagles and how he was expected to be a developmental guy with NHL aspirations. We reminisce about Rich's years playing and how some of his fondest memories with skill players and protectors shifted his coaching mentality.

Then we talk about how the game has shifted towards speed and whether or not his style would be a better fit for the modern game and what it was like to share a locker room with NHL Stanley Cup champion and Olympic Gold Medalist, Theoren Fleury.

Lastly, we talk about his last season playing in North America, winning championships in Europe, and what he's been up to lately.
